BREAKDOWN
SEEKING THE FOLLOWING:
STRAT
(Lead, 18+ to play 18): Male; All Ethnicities. Strat is the young and rebellious leader of a gang of misfit who’ll never grow up. Fearless physical actor, idealistic, valorous, and madly in love with the daughter of the oppressive FALCO; must bring a wild, raw energy to an excellent rock/pop tenor a la Freddie Mercury voice and an Iggy Pop physicality — to a HIGH C.
RAVEN
(Lead, 18+ to play 17-18): Female; All Ethnicities. The beautiful and zealously-sheltered, teen-aged, daughter of the tyrannous FALCO. No longer willing to be locked down, RAVEN will risk everything for STRAT; must bring a rebellious, non-conformist attitude to an ingènue character with an excellent pop/rock lyric soprano voice: HIGH ROCK’n’ROLL BELT to E.
FALCO
(Supporting, 45-50): Male; All Ethnicities. Rules THE CITY OF OBSIDIAN with unbridled cruelty. A jealous, angry, animal of a man, FALCO is a tyrant with a sense of humor, sexy, with a sharp as nails wit, FALCO must have a beautiful, if comic, sometimes frightening ROCK’n’ROLL BARI/TENOR to Bb with strong FALSETTO.
SLOANE
(Supporting, 45-50): Female; All Ethnicities. Seemingly resigned but decidedly independent mother to RAVEN who’s on the verge of walking out on her husband, FALCO. Seeking a physically-daring singer with a razor sharp sense of humor and a sexy rock-and-roll sensibility. ROCK’n’ROLL BELT to HIGH E.
ZAHARA
(Supporting, 30-45); Female; All Ethnicities. De facto cool girl, hanging with the LOST, rides a motorcycle. SOUL BELT to HIGH E
TINK
(Supporting, 18+ to play 14-16): Male; All Ethnicities. TINK is the youngest of The LOST defined by an unquenchable love for his “ultimate big brother.” Similar vocal type as STRAT. ROCK’n’ROLL TENOR, to Bb TOP.
